
Manchester Collective invites audiences on an extraordinary sonic expedition that traverses expansive musical landscapes, from the crystalline horizons of Alaska to otherworldly sonic territories.
John Luther Adams' 'Canticles of the Sky' forms the centrepiece of this performance, a string quartet work inspired by the Arctic's luminous phenomena - where sunbeams dance across ice crystals, creating vivid halos and sundogs. The composition captures the subtle, steady transformation of light and landscape, offering listeners a profound sensory experience of northern wilderness.
Complementing Adams' work, the programme features Arvo Pärt's 'Summa', a piece renowned for its radiant simplicity, and a new commissioned work by Jasmine Morris that promises to manipulate time and perception through slow-evolving, otherworldly textures.
The evening also features a rare opportunity to experience music inspired by Mica Levi's experimental approach, known for groundbreaking film scores that challenge conventional musical boundaries.
Sky With the Four Suns is not just a concert, but a journey through sound that promises to transport the Howard Assembly Room far beyond the familiar.
